Song of the day: U2/"Sometimes You Can't Make It On Your Own"

The wait is over for U2 fans. The band's new album, How to Dismantle an Atomic Bomb, was added to Rhapsody last Thursday, after an extensive period of exclusivity on Apple's iTunes Music Store. While I'm not a fan (*at all*) of the kind of hype this album has received, the song "Sometimes You Can't Make It On Your Own" has been on my mind since seeing U2 perform it live on Saturday Night Live last fall. At the time, I was blown away by the Edge's guitar lick at the start of the song, which recalled his sound on some of his best work -- songs like "Some Sort of Homecoming" (from The Unforgettable Fire) and "With or Without You" (from The Joshua Tree). Throw in the emotional content of the lyrics, which Bono wrote about the death of his father, and you've got a winner. Enjoy the music!
